• 제목/요약/키워드: 1-D 시뮬레이션

검색결과 1,437건 처리시간 0.039초

객체 모델을 이용한 HLA기반 시뮬레이션의 게이트웨이 설계 방법 (A Design Method of Gateway for HLA based Simulation using Object Model)

  • 심준용;이용헌;김세환
    • 한국정보처리학회:학술대회논문집
    • /
    • 한국정보처리학회 2011년도 추계학술발표대회
    • /
    • pp.1334-1337
    • /
    • 2011
  • HLA(High Level Architecture)는 분산 환경의 모델링 및 시뮬레이션(Modeling & Simulation)을 위한 공통 아키텍처를 제공하는 기술 표준이며, RTI(Run-Time Infrastructure)를 통해 HLA 서비스를 제공한다. HLA는 연동 객체 모델인 FOM(Federation Object Model)을 기반으로 시뮬레이션 환경을 구성하며, 시뮬레이션에 참여하는 모든 시뮬레이터는 동일한 FOM을 소유해야 한다. 따라서 시뮬레이션 체계 간 연동을 수행하기 위해서는 FOM을 통합하거나 FOM 간 연동을 위한 게이트웨이를 구현해야 한다. 한편, FOM을 통합하는 방법은 각 시뮬레이션의 연동 인터페이스 수정이 필요하기 때문에 게이트웨이를 구현하는 방법이 기존 시스템의 변경을 최소화할 수 있다. 따라서 본 논문은 HLA기반 시뮬레이션의 체계 간 연동을 제공할 수 있는 게이트웨이 구조를 제시한다. 특히, XML 형태의 객체 모델을 기반으로 교환 메시지를 정의하고, 메시지 처리 모듈을 게이트웨이에 플러그인 함으로써 시뮬레이션 체계 간 연동의 용이함을 보여준다.

3D 시뮬레이션을 활용한 렌즈모듈 자동화조립시스템 개발 (Developing Automatic Lens Module Assembly System Using 3D Simulation)

  • 문덕희;이준석;백승근;장병림;김영규
    • 한국시뮬레이션학회논문지
    • /
    • 제16권2호
    • /
    • pp.65-74
    • /
    • 2007
  • 가상생산기술은 신제품의 개발, 새로운 장비 개발 및 새로운 제조시스템 개발에 유용한 도구이며, 특히 3D 시뮬레이션 기술은 가상생산의 핵심기술이다. 3D 시뮬레이션 기술은 기계적 시뮬레이션 기술과 이산사건 시뮬레이션 기술로 구분할 수 있다. 본 논문에서는 휴대폰 카메라에 장착되는 렌즈모듈 조립을 생산하는 국내 회사의 사례를 소개한다. 이 회사에서는 렌즈모듈 조립공정을 현재 수작업으로 하고 있는데 자동화시스템을 개발하기로 결정하였으며 이를 위해 3D 시뮬레이션 기술을 도입하기로 하였다. 3D 시뮬레이션 기술은 시스템 개념설계단계에서부터 적용이 되었는데, 단위 장비 개발을 위해서는 $CATIA^{(R)}$$IGRIP^{(R)}$이 활용되었으며, 시스템 설계를 위해서는 이산사건 시뮬레이션 도구인 $QUEST^{(R)}$가 활용되었다. 논문의 목적은 새로운 자동화 설비의 기술적. 경제적 타당성을 검증하는 것이다. 개발결과 takt time 이 기존의 수작업에 비해 4분의 1 수준으로 감소되었으며, 이에 따른 작업자 인원도 대폭 감소되었다.

  • PDF

XML 형태의 객체 모델 기반 시뮬레이션 시나리오 스키마 설계 (a Design of Simulation Scenario Schema using XML based on Object Model)

  • 오정인;심준용;이용헌;위성혁
    • 한국정보처리학회:학술대회논문집
    • /
    • 한국정보처리학회 2011년도 추계학술발표대회
    • /
    • pp.1555-1558
    • /
    • 2011
  • 국방 모델링 및 시뮬레이션(Modeling & Simulation) 소프트웨어 분야에서 분산 시뮬레이션 기술표준인 HLA(High Level Architecture)의 적용이 늘어나고 있으며, 시뮬레이션 요소의 재사용성 및 신뢰성 확보를 위한 개발 프레임워크 제공이 핵심기술로 떠오르고 있다. 특히, 시뮬레이션을 위한 공통 서비스를 제공하는 M&S 프레임워크가 개발되었다. 또한, 가상의 시험 환경을 제공하기 위한 요소 중 시험환경의 구성을 위한 시나리오 모델이 있다. 본 논문에서는 시험 환경을 구성하기 위한 M&S 프레임워크 내의 시나리오의 스키마 설계에 대해서 기술한다.

단일 및 분산 컴퓨팅 환경에서 모델 연동을 위한 플러그인 방식의 인터페이스 설계 방안 연구 (A Study on the Design Idea for Plug-in based Simulation Network on Single and Distributed Computing Environment)

  • 심준용;이용헌;김세환
    • 한국정보처리학회:학술대회논문집
    • /
    • 한국정보처리학회 2011년도 춘계학술발표대회
    • /
    • pp.1375-1378
    • /
    • 2011
  • 국방 분야의 모델링 및 시뮬레이션(Modeling & Simulation) 분야에서 재사용성 및 상호운용성 확보는 기 개발된 모델을 연동하여 시뮬레이션을 확장할 수 있다는 측면에서 핵심이 된다. 이러한 핵심기술 확보를 위해 시뮬레이션 소프트웨어의 공통 컴포넌트를 설계하고, 표준 연동 미들웨어인 Run-Time Infrastructure(RTI)를 적용한 프레임워크가 개발되었다. 한편, 시뮬레이션 환경은 목적에 따라 시뮬레이션 모델의 기능이 달라지거나, 동일한 모델이 분산 컴퓨팅뿐만 아니라 단일 컴퓨팅 환경에서도 수행되도록 요구된다. 본 논문은 이러한 요구사항을 만족시킬 수 있도록 모델 연동을 위한 플러그인 방식의 인터페이스 설계 방안을 제시하고, 분산 시뮬레이션의 동일한 모델을 단일 시스템에서 시뮬레이션 할 경우 모델 컴포넌트 간 데이터 교환 및 메시지 순서화를 제공할 수 있는 메커니즘을 기술한다.

가스터빈엔진을 모의하기 위한 시뮬레이션덕트 설계 연구 (Design Study of a Simulation Duct for Gas Turbine Engine Operations)

  • 임주현;김선제;김명호;김유일;김용련
    • 한국추진공학회지
    • /
    • 제23권1호
    • /
    • pp.124-131
    • /
    • 2019
  • 가스터빈엔진 고도시험설비 운용특성탐색 및 설비튜닝 연구와 유량/추력 측정방안 검증을 위한 엔진 시뮬레이션덕트 설계 연구를 수행하였다. 설비 운용특성 검증은 배압/추력 제어가 필요하므로 Spikecone type의 가변노즐을 적용하였으며, 유량검증용 ISO 쵸킹노즐의 추가장착이 가능토록 설계하였다. 시뮬레이션덕트 주유로 면적은 1D Sizing으로 결정하고, 노즐면적변화에 따른 시뮬레이션덕트 내부 유동특성은 1D/CFD 해석으로 조사하였으며, 해석결과로부터 설비운용특성 탐색 및 유량/추력 검증시험을 위한 공기공급부 시험조건을 도출하였다. Spike 노즐 구동부는 시험 전운용 구간에서 공력하중조건을 견디도록 모터, 리니어 볼스크류 등의 부품모델을 선정하였으며, 시험 시 10 mm/s의 이송속도가 가능하도록 설계하였다.

컴포넌트 재사용을 위한 DLL 플러그인 프레임워크 설계 (A Design of DLL Plug-in Framework for Component Reuse)

  • 심준용;이용헌;김세환
    • 한국정보처리학회:학술대회논문집
    • /
    • 한국정보처리학회 2010년도 추계학술발표대회
    • /
    • pp.232-235
    • /
    • 2010
  • 최근 국방 소프트웨어 분야에서는 모델링 및 시뮬레이션 기술이 각광받으면서 무기체계 개발을 위한 시뮬레이션 소프트웨어 개발 사업을 늘리고 있다. 특히, 시뮬레이션 요소의 재사용성 및 신뢰성 확보를 위한 개발 프레임워크 제공이 핵심기술로 떠오르면서, 시뮬레이션을 위한 공통 서비스를 제공하는 M&S 프레임워크가 개발되었다. 하지만 고객의 요구사항이 프레임워크의 기능 변경을 요구하는 경우 프레임워크가 적용된 모든 시뮬레이션 요소의 수정이 불가피하며, 추가 구성요소의 상호작용을 위한 인터페이스 재설계가 요구된다. 본 논문은 이러한 문제점을 해결하기 위해서 프레임워크의 요소를 DLL로 구현하여 기능 구성을 용이하게 하고, 구성요소 간 상호작용을 위해 데이터 기반 Publish-Subscribe 방식을 사용함으로써 프레임워크와 독립적으로 인터페이스를 설계할 수 있도록 한다. 특히, 프레임워크와 DLL 간 교환 메시지 객체에 대한 구조 설계를 제시한다.

링크 용량계획을 위한 분석적 시뮬레이션 기법 연구 (A Study on Analytical Simulation Technique for Link Capacity Planning)

  • 장택수;한정규
    • 한국정보처리학회:학술대회논문집
    • /
    • 한국정보처리학회 2011년도 추계학술발표대회
    • /
    • pp.504-506
    • /
    • 2011
  • 네트워크 관리자는 트래픽 증가에 따른 네트워크 성능저하 문제를 해결하기 위해 개별 링크에 필요한 용량을 산정해야할 때가 있다. 대규모 네트워크의 경우 이산 사건 시뮬레이션만을 수행하여 용량을 산정하는 것보다 분석적 시뮬레이션을 함께 사용하여 용량을 산정한다면 시뮬레이션에 필요한 시간을 줄일 수 있다. 본 논문에서는 링크 용량계획을 위한 분석적 시뮬레이션의 활용방안을 논하고 그 기법을 기술하였다. 제안한 분석적 시뮬레이션 기법은 정상상태의 네트워크 분석이기 때문에 이산 사건 시뮬레이션에 비해 시뮬레이션에 소요되는 시간은 작지만 정확도는 낮다. 하지만 대규모 네트워크의 상태를 빠르게 파악하고 문제를 해결해야 한다면 좀 더 정밀한 시뮬레이션이나 분석을 위한 사전자료를 만들기에 충분할 것이다.

1-D 시뮬레이션을 활용한 핀틀추력기의 성능해석 -I : 정상상태 특성 (Performance Analysis of the Pintle Thruster Using 1-D Simulation -I : Steady State Characteristics)

  • 김지홍;노성현;허환일
    • 한국항공우주학회지
    • /
    • 제43권4호
    • /
    • pp.304-310
    • /
    • 2015
  • 핀틀추력기는 추력조절을 위해 노즐목면적을 조절하는 핀틀 스트로크 개념을 사용한다. 충남대학교에서 수행한 공압시험용 핀틀추력기에 대해 MATLAB을 사용하여 1-D 시뮬레이션 성능예측 기법을 연구하였고 전산수치해석과 1-D 시뮬레이션을 수행하여 결과를 비교하였다. 일차원 유동이론에 근거한 성능예측결과는 챔버압력에 대해 경향성 뿐만 아니라 계산값까지 유사한 것을 확인하였지만, 노즐벽면의 박리로 인해 추력에 대해서는 오차가 존재하였다. 수치해석 결과로 모든 핀틀 스트로크 구간에서 노즐의 확장부 부분의 설계 노즐목 부근에서 유동박리가 발생하는 것을 확인하였다. 엠피리컬(Empirical) 추력예측 법은 노즐벽면의 박리를 포함하며, 1-D 엠피리컬 시뮬레이션은 초기 핀틀 스트로크 구간에서 추력을 잘 예측하였다.

항만 컨테이너 시뮬레이션을 위한 대규모 3D 가시화 시스템 개발 (A Large-Scale 3D Visualization System for Port Container Terminal Simulation)

  • 옥수열
    • 한국정보통신학회논문지
    • /
    • 제19권1호
    • /
    • pp.119-126
    • /
    • 2015
  • 본 논문에서는 항만컨테이너 운영 모니터링 및 계획 시뮬레이션의 결과를 3차원으로 정적 동적 개체를 포함하는 주변 환경의 거동을 시각적으로 표현하고 실제 작업이 이루어지는 애니메이션을 통해 운영모델을 직관적으로 평가가 가능한 시뮬레이션 가시화 시스템을 제안한다. 제안한 항만 시뮬레이션 가시화 시스템(PSVS)은 객체의 상태를 XML기반으로 설계하여 기존의 항만 운영 시뮬레이션(CATOS)과 상호운용성에 있어서 연동성을 극대화하고 실시간으로 대규모 객체에 대한 애니메이션 표현이 가능하도록 구현하였다. 본 논문에서는 PSVS시스템의 설계 방법에 대해서 설명하고 실험을 통해 PSVS의 타당성을 검토하였다.